Masculinity

Episode 118

Masculinity

with Simon Smart, Michael Jensen, and Megan Powell du Toit

What does it look like to be a Christian man in the 21st century?

Is there a masculinity crisis? Or have we fundamentally misunderstood what being a man in the 21st century means?

Our hosts spend some time discussing their understanding of masculinity, how they’ve seen it shift around them, and what a Christian vision of masculinity really looks like.

Executive Director of the Centre for Public Christianity Simon Smart joins the show to discuss this tricky topic.

Finally, Michael and Megan turn their attention to the comedy-drama series Barry.
